Geriatric Oncology Survivorship Career Roles (UK) Description
Geriatric Oncology Nurse Consultant Specialised nursing role focusing on holistic care for older cancer survivors, integrating oncology expertise with geriatric principles. High demand.
Geriatric Oncology Pharmacist Manages medication regimens for older cancer patients, considering age-related factors and potential drug interactions. Growing need.
Geriatric Oncologist Medical doctor specialising in treating cancer in older adults; requires extensive training and experience. High salary potential.
Geriatric Oncology Physiotherapist Provides rehabilitation and physical therapy to older cancer survivors, improving mobility and quality of life. Increasing demand.
Geriatric Oncology Social Worker Supports older cancer patients and their families, addressing social and emotional needs, coordinating care and resources. Essential role.

Global Certificate Course in Geriatric Oncology Survivorship is increasingly significant given the UK's aging population and rising cancer incidence. The number of older adults diagnosed with cancer is projected to increase substantially. This necessitates specialized training in geriatric oncology survivorship care, addressing the unique needs of this vulnerable population. The course equips healthcare professionals with the knowledge and skills to provide holistic, patient-centered care.

According to Cancer Research UK, approximately 40% of all cancer diagnoses in the UK are in people aged 75 or over. This underlines the critical demand for professionals with expertise in geriatric oncology. The course addresses this demand by offering comprehensive training in areas such as age-related comorbidities, polypharmacy, and effective communication with older patients and their families. The holistic approach ensures improved quality of life for cancer survivors of advanced age.
